Transaction 36223f516db6fa6f719590d886b6e21321d4bf80bf99222c38a667e6acc6d902

block
27e8511a2725d76b5e482e21b4e9b424530effb65b7cde16d8a2b9d3c63020b4

1 Input

24 Outputs